Output d21480ef25bf4f672ab7e10a23333818f92251172003b8a6b27e6b189f1a0b3b:0

value
15833633
script pubkey
OP_0 OP_PUSHBYTES_20 2678043910bddc3946ac9818be2a8333d3008fb5
address
ltc1qyeuqgwgshhwrj34vnqvtu25rx0fspra4kxzezn
transaction
d21480ef25bf4f672ab7e10a23333818f92251172003b8a6b27e6b189f1a0b3b
spent
true